Friend of mine and his wife were attacked in their home. Tied up with wire and left whilst the house was ransacked. The old man got loose and snuck off to the cupboard and retrieved a little .25 baby Browning. He found one of the critters in a bedroom and walked up behind him and shot him twice through the lower back. The noise was enough to scare the two of them right outta the house! They never found a body but we believe that he was hospitalised in another part of the country!
ALWAYS HAVE ENOUGH GUN!
